The Utica Boilers 1401003 is an air pressure switch designed for use in residential and light commercial heating systems. It is a single-pole double-throw (SPDT) switch rated at 0.5 inches water column (WC). This component plays a critical role in the safe operation of induced-draft and forced-draft boilers. The switch monitors the negative pressure created by the draft inducer motor. If the inducer fails to produce the correct airflow, the switch prevents the burner from firing. This protects the system from operating under unsafe flue gas conditions. HVAC technicians rely on this type of pressure switch during routine maintenance, diagnostics, and component replacement. The barb fitting connection makes installation straightforward and compatible with standard pressure tubing used in most boiler setups. The SPDT configuration allows the switch to break one circuit and make another simultaneously, giving the boiler control board accurate feedback on draft status. A faulty or out-of-calibration pressure switch is a common cause of boiler lockout codes. Replacing the switch with a correctly rated OEM-spec unit like the 1401003 restores reliable ignition sequencing. This part is specific to Utica Boilers and Dunkirk heating equipment, both of which share a product platform under the same manufacturing group. Technicians should verify the set point and fitting size before installation to confirm compatibility with the target unit. The 0.5 inches WC set point is a common rating found in many residential boiler models. Keeping this switch in stock reduces downtime during heating season service calls.
